She handles high-end real estate transactions
Skye is a real-estate agent with Premier Realty Services, a California-based realty company.
In 2022, Skye assisted her husband in selling a US$28.5 million Beverly Hills estate previously owned by American actor Mark Wahlberg.
The Hankeys dedicated approximately four years to renovating the property, they stated. To improve the main home’s canyon views, they demolished walls and added more windows. They also revamped the floors and ceilings, modernized the appliances, and incorporated smart home technology, according to Kane Bridge News.

Skye’s husband Rufus used to work as a general sales manager at Midway Ford, a car dealership once managed by his late grandfather.
After five years, Rufus then served as a board director at Westlake Finance, a finance company under his father’s Hankey Group.
Rufus has reportedly since established his own housing development company, Knight Development Group, under the Hankey Group.
